Fourteen innovators in Chicago, Detroit, Los Angeles, New Orleans, New York and Philadelphia to obtain seed funding from a pool of over $1M, mentorship and more to progress well being equity methods
NEW BRUNSWICK, N.J., June 14, 2022 /PRNewswire/ — After an substantial lookup for the leading changemakers in six crucial U.S. metropolitan areas, Johnson & Johnson now introduced the 14 awardees of its Overall health Equity Innovation Problem. The awardees, who possess lived practical experience and a deep knowledge of the communities they provide, had been selected for their function in making solutions to support shut racial well being and mortality gaps in six metropolitan areas exactly where Black and Brown folks experience significant overall health inequities: Chicago, Detroit, Los Angeles, New Orleans, New York Metropolis and Philadelphia.

The Overall health Fairness Innovation Challenge was made by Johnson & Johnson as a component of the firm’s “Our Race to Health Equity,” a daring, aspirational commitment to assist eradicate the general public well being threats of racial and social injustices by getting rid of wellbeing inequities for folks of shade. The Challenge aims to foster innovation, entrepreneurship, and socioeconomic effects by supporting innovative answers from community business people, get started-ups, innovators, and group-dependent companies that have the opportunity to advance wellness equity.
Chosen from a pool of more than 180 candidates by an impartial judging committee, every single awardee is getting seed funding from a pool of more than $1 million from Johnson & Johnson Products and services, Inc., mentorship from renowned business people and community wellbeing professionals, and access to the Johnson & Johnson – JLABS ecosystem, which contains networking prospects and far more, to progress their innovations. Just one this sort of awardee, Previously Incarcerated Transitions (Match) Clinic, is centered on minimizing recidivism and bettering health results by offering continuity of treatment and other reintegration methods for formerly incarcerated people today.

Chicago, IL Awardees
- A program from the Allergy & Asthma Community, Not 1 Additional Daily life – Dependable Messengers Program, sends medical professionals, nurses and educators to areas of worship to mitigate the effects of COVID-19, bronchial asthma, and COPD in Black and Latinx communities. To day, the pilot has efficiently screened in excess of 1,000 clients, and Problem cash will be made use of to develop programming by live activities and instructional supplies.
- CommunityHealth has piloted hybrid in-human being and telehealth-driven microsite clinics in beneath-resourced neighborhoods to deliver absolutely free, hassle-free, comprehensive healthcare to men and women who if not would not have entry to quality treatment. Problem funds will assist the opening of an further microsite clinic in Chicago’s Small Village, a predominantly Latinx community with a significant population of uninsured people.
Detroit, MI Awardees
- The Black Mothers’ Breastfeeding Association (BMBFA) is combating racial disparities in toddler and maternal mortality and, in change, performing to make improvements to start and maternal well being results for Black households with its modern electronic resource, the BMBFA B’Right Hub. Problem resources will allow BMBFA to develop the access and scope of its interactive app and net-based resource with a aim on five overarching types: breastfeeding, prenatal treatment, postpartum care, immunizations and properly-child visits.
- Sixty-a few million folks in the U.S. dwell in dental deserts. KARE Mobile has piloted a single-chair, cell dentistry vans that increase obtain to quality oral treatment for beneath- and uninsured communities though at the same time empowering young dentists to go after price-powerful follow possession by a franchise company design. Funds will be applied to grow these providers to Detroit, MI in collaboration with community companions.
Los Angeles, CA Awardees
- Utilizing a deep comprehending of lived Latinx experiences and the value of weaving society into mental health interventions, Mindful Cultura is acquiring a electronic system that delivers youth, educators and communities with proof-dependent systems that progress perfectly-becoming and fairness. Challenge resources will be employed to deliver the Mindful Cultura plan in-man or woman to youth and educators within the Los Angeles Unified School District as investigation and growth to style and design technological innovation and make written content that meets the needs of the area schools and communities.
- In Los Angeles, Black and Latinx children are more most likely to miss out on a working day of school than their White peers thanks to bronchial asthma. SmartAirLA is combatting asthma-similar hospitalizations, sickness and air pollution exposure to strengthen good quality of existence for communities of shade. Problem cash will assist enlargement of their digital FightAsthma Tracker at local community asthma education and learning courses, and security-internet health clinics and hospitals.
- By creating the potential of barbershops to perform as dependable level-of-care venues, Lure Medicine is furnishing free of charge, high-quality onsite healthcare services and education and learning to handle wellbeing disparities, mental health and fitness inequities and other preventable disorders among the Black males. Obstacle funds will be utilized to pilot a standalone Barbershop Wellness Hub, exactly where adult men ages 18-35 can access a array of professional medical, mental health, and wraparound providers. Through this period of time Entice Drugs will also perform to detect pathways to scale this product to other locations in the course of the state and nation.
New Orleans, LA Awardees
- To address the 15- to 25-yr everyday living expectancy hole amongst White and Black New Orleanians, Ashé Cultural Art Center’s I Have earned It! is education artists and culture bearers to provide as community well being staff that supply wellness messaging, assets and instruction to inhabitants of neighborhoods with weak health outcomes. Problem cash will be utilised to educate and hire more artists and creatives to provide as group overall health workers.
- Led by formerly incarcerated folks who intimately fully grasp the challenges of transitioning again into modern society, the Previously Incarcerated Transitions (Suit) Clinic and Formerly Incarcerated Peer Aid Group (FIPS) purpose to minimize recidivism and improve health outcomes by giving continuity of treatment, no cost well being services, and reintegration assets for the formerly incarcerated. Obstacle funding will be applied to help personnel salaries and employ pre-release wellness methods education and learning.
- Resilience Power is a job improvement and disaster reaction firm that retrains less than- or unemployed New Orleanians from the hospitality market as local community wellness workers in work that assist speedy and lengthy-term local community recovery. Challenge money will let for extra coaching, wellbeing and work advantages, technologies help and the deployment of far more local community health staff.
New York Metropolis, NY Awardee
- The Arthur Ashe Institute for City Well being released Further than the Stigma, a youth-centered, peer-to-peer schooling design to produce a culturally tailor-made curriculum that breaks societal and cultural stigmas all around mental wellness and wellness. Obstacle resources will help enlargement of the organization’s curriculum products to deal with new and more subject areas with youth, such as racial trauma, suicide, masculinity, identity and extra.
Philadelphia, PA Awardees
- eCLOSE Institute is inspiring diversity in science through STEM education and learning and work schooling for pupils from below-resourced educational facilities. Their classroom-based programming delivers teachers, researchers and pupils together to look into remedies that deal with the health troubles widespread in their individual communities. Obstacle money will enable them to extend exploration activities for pupils at 10 new universities.
- Philadelphia’s being pregnant-related loss of life and toddler mortality prices exceed the nationwide common, but Maternity Treatment Coalition is addressing these inequities, bettering beginning results, and growing accessibility to culturally linked and knowledgeable perinatal health care for Black and Brown family members. Considering that its generation, the Perinatal Local community Well being Employee System has experienced a numerous network of about 200 perinatal group wellbeing personnel, and funding will assistance develop an extra teaching cohort to assist even far more community people of colour.
- Technological innovation start-up Viora Well being is producing a individualized engagement resolution to deal with social and behavioral determinants for situations like pre-diabetic issues, diabetic issues and obesity, which appreciably impact communities of coloration. Obstacle money will extend remedies to more conditions, including hypertension, to support beat the limitations that avert the correct management of overall health ailments.
